Synopsis:
On 5/11/70,
b7C
for Administrative Services, INS, Terminal Island, Cali-.
fornia, furnished information regarding an accident
experienced by HARLON B. CARTER, Regional Commissioner,.
INS, Terminal Island, when his automobile struck and.
killed a pedestrian named LUTHER CURLy in Riverside,
California. .California Highway Patrol reports set forth.
reflecting the details of this accident. LEONARD W..
GILmAN, Deputy Regional Commissioner in Charge of Opera.
tions, who was a passenger in the vehicle,'interviewed.
by the FBI.
Investigation continuing.

HARLON B. CARTER, Regional Commissioner, INS,
Terminal Island, California, was driving a Government owned.
vehicle (196g Chevrolet, California License ZAK 135) on.
official business at 12:05 a.m., May 10, 1970, when he struck.
Freeway near the City of Riverside,.
California.
